Hi @Dinnyloo  Try rebooting both your router and Glass/puck.   They can both be done by unplugging them for a couple of minutes and then plugging them back in again and allowing them to reboot.  Do the router first and wait for it to completely reboot before doing the Glass/puck.

 

If that doesn't help then go to settings / network / Network connection and reset it.  Make sure you have your SSID and password handy.

 

If you are still having issues have a look at the following links to see if they help but if not you will need to call Sky for more troubleshooting.
